Output e0f15f9c763a4bcf503154a340a33d9476bd08dfc3aaeb4f84df0d85dff95cfe:66

value
3144209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5790be1e3b9d40453c8586140c8b23985fcefa0 OP_EQUAL
address
3M9krrbwYP4miYPMNUkWgKKmVw3Y574N5h
transaction
e0f15f9c763a4bcf503154a340a33d9476bd08dfc3aaeb4f84df0d85dff95cfe
spent
true